收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 海洋水文散点图绘制的技巧与方法——Matlab实战指南!

[复制链接]
海洋水文散点图绘制是海洋行业中常用的数据可视化方法。通过散点图,我们可以直观地展示海洋水文数据的分布规律,发现其中的关联和趋势,为科研和决策提供重要依据。本篇文章将介绍一些在使用Matlab进行海洋水文散点图绘制时的技巧和方法。
0 u/ C5 f2 B" X5 h5 J. \) }  \( f0 l- r
首先,要绘制出准确、美观的散点图,我们首先需要准备好数据。海洋水文数据通常包括海洋温度、盐度、流速等多个参数。这些参数可以通过观测站点采集得到,并以表格形式存储。在绘制散点图之前,我们需要对数据进行预处理,包括数据清洗、缺失值填充等。Matlab提供了丰富的数据处理函数和工具箱,可以方便地进行这些操作。
% c8 W# y. ?: a# L
# q1 T+ |& A: G* b$ ~其次,在绘制散点图之前,我们需要选择合适的散点图类型。在海洋水文领域,常见的散点图类型有普通散点图、气泡图、极坐标散点图等。不同的类型适用于不同的数据情况和分析目的。例如,普通散点图适用于两个数值型变量之间的关系展示,而气泡图则可以利用不同大小的气泡显示第三个数值型变量的信息。选择合适的散点图类型可以更好地呈现数据的特征。
) Q. Y  _5 g  |9 j6 L$ t
/ w/ _3 ^# Q6 ?& U8 {然后,我们需要确定散点图的坐标轴范围和刻度。通过设置合适的坐标轴范围和刻度,可以使得散点图的展示更加清晰和准确。在Matlab中,可以利用`xlim`和`ylim`函数来设置横纵坐标轴的范围,利用`xticks`和`yticks`函数来设置坐标轴刻度。此外,还可以通过`axis equal`函数来保持横纵坐标轴的比例一致,以便更好地观察散点的分布情况。
+ K7 O3 ^- n) \3 }0 ?+ a, {! g
4 A5 |0 P" W9 x; y4 B( `接下来,我们需要选择合适的绘图符号和颜色。在海洋水文散点图中,散点通常用圆圈表示,颜色可以根据不同的标志变量进行区分。Matlab提供了丰富的绘图符号和颜色选择函数,如`plot`、`scatter`、`line`等,可以根据实际需求进行选择和设置。同时,可以利用配色方案和颜色映射函数,如`colormap`、`colorbar`等,使得散点图更加美观和易于理解。0 v! }! \; I# t( c3 p

; e6 x2 @" k8 s' O0 P最后,我们还可以对散点图进行进一步的修饰和注释,以增加信息量和可读性。例如,可以添加标题、坐标轴标签、图例注释等,以便更好地解释图像的含义和结果。此外,还可以利用Matlab提供的文本绘制函数和箭头绘制函数,对特殊的数据点进行标注和说明,提取出更有价值的信息。
2 u) y1 N: O% X* j7 H+ N" Z8 \# A' A+ \
总之,在海洋水文领域,Matlab是一个强大的工具,可以帮助我们方便地绘制出准确、美观的散点图。通过合理选择散点图类型、设置坐标轴范围和刻度、选择绘图符号和颜色、修饰和注释图像,我们可以更好地展示海洋水文数据的分布特征和规律,为科研和决策提供有力支持。希望通过本篇文章的介绍,能够帮助读者更好地掌握Matlab在海洋水文散点图绘制中的技巧和方法。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
Om_MyGad
活跃在2022-2-8
快速回复 返回顶部 返回列表